Adverse Effects of IL-12
Event . | Number . |
---|---|
Myalgias | 5 |
Chills | 4 |
Fatigue* | 2 |
Loose stools | 2 |
Elevated liver enzymes† | 2 |
Loss of appetite | 2 |
Headache | 2 |
Depression‡ | 1 |
Leukopenia | 1 |

Fatigue occurred in one patient entered at 300 ng/kg and in one patient dose-escalated to 300 ng/kg necessitating dose decrease in both cases.
Elevated liver enzymes occurred in the context of alcohol ingestion at a dose of 300 ng/kg and rapidly returned to baseline values with the holding of a single dose of rhIL-12.
Depression occurred at a dose of 100 ng/kg necessitating discontinuation of rhIL-12. This patient had experienced severe depression during the previous administration of recombinant IFN-α.
